Lots of GOLD for Southwest Ontario Wineries

Posted by Gary Killops on May 21, 2010

Although medal count is down this year compared to last year more GOLD and DOUBLE awards were handed out to several local wineries at the 2010 All Canadian Wine Championships. The ACWC was established in 1981 and is Canada’s oldest wine awards.

Wineries from seven provinces participated at this year’s competition. British Columbia, Ontario, Quebec, Alberta, Nova Scotia, Price Edward Island and New Brunswick.

Eight wineries in Southwestern Ontario (Lake Erie North Shore and Pelee Island) were awarded a total of 18 medals including 4 double gold and 4 gold.

4 – DOUBLE GOLD
4 – GOLD
4 – SILVER
6 – BRONZE
18 total

Pelee Island Winery
2009 Blanc de Blanc – DOUBLE GOLD
2008 Late Harvest Vidal – GOLD
Chardonnay Unoaked – GOLD
2008 Cabernet- Merlot – SILVER
208 Baco Noir – SILVER
2008 Riesling Dry – BRONZE
2008 Cabernet Sauvignon – BRONZE

Black Bear Farm Estate Winery
2008 Elderberry – DOUBLE GOLD
2008 Golden Plum – Silver
2008 Red Raspberry & Purple Plum – BRONZE

Aleksander Estate Winery
2008 Chambourcin – DOUBLE GOLD
2008 Baco Noir – GOLD

D’Angelo Winery
Dolce Vita – DOUBLE GOLD

Sanson Estate Winery
2007 Syrah – GOLD

Sprucewood Shores Estate Winery
2007 Meritage – SILVER
2009 Riesling – BRONZE

Mastronardi Estate Winery
2007 Cabernet Sauvignon – BRONZE

Muscedere Vineyards
2009 Vidal Blanc – BRONZE
